  • Patent number: 9315045
    Abstract: An image forming apparatus includes a media roll, art image forming device, and a feeder. In the media roll, a printing medium having an adhesive face is wound in a roll shape. The image forming device forms an image on the printing medium. The feeder feeds the printing medium. The feeder includes a protection belt and a pair of rotary bodies. The protection belt presses against and protects the adhesive face of the printing medium. The pair of rotary bodies sandwich and press the printing medium and the protection belt between the pair of rotary bodies. An approach angle of the printing medium is within a range from 0° to 30° and is formed by the printing medium drawn from the media roll and approaching to between the pair of rotary bodies and an opposing face of the protection belt opposing the image forming device.

  • Patent number: 9233560
    Abstract: An image forming apparatus includes an image forming device to form an image on a print medium by a reciprocation operation of a print head. There is a conveying device including a belt that holds the print medium, a fan that adsorbs air through suction holes in the belt, and a fan drive controller that drives the suction fan and adjusts power of adsorption of the suction fan. The fan drive controller performs control which makes the power of adsorption for the first reciprocation movement of the image forming device stronger than the power of adsorption for the second reciprocation movement of the image forming device.

  • Patent number: 8911054
    Abstract: An image forming apparatus includes an image forming device, a belt member, a reflection-type photosensor, and a reflection member. The belt member includes plural suction holes to attract a printing medium onto the belt member. The reflection member reflects light from the reflection-type photosensor through the suction holes. The reflection member is disposed inside the belt member. The reflection member has a reflection rate at which, when the reflection-type photosensor receives reflection light at positions of the suction holes with a transparent printing medium being not present on the belt member, a sensor output of the reflection-type photosensor is lower than a predetermined reference value, and when the reflection-type photosensor receives reflection light at the positions of the suction holes with the transparent printing medium being present on the belt member, a sensor output of the reflection-type photosensor is equal to or greater than the predetermined reference value.
